Jacob D. Mikula is a scholar working on Surgery, Epidemiology and Orthopedics and Sports Medicine. According to data from OpenAlex, Jacob D. Mikula has authored 45 papers receiving a total of 618 indexed citations (citations by other indexed papers that have themselves been cited), including 42 papers in Surgery, 16 papers in Epidemiology and 10 papers in Orthopedics and Sports Medicine. Recurrent topics in Jacob D. Mikula's work include Shoulder Injury and Treatment (22 papers), Shoulder and Clavicle Injuries (15 papers) and Total Knee Arthroplasty Outcomes (15 papers). Jacob D. Mikula is often cited by papers focused on Shoulder Injury and Treatment (22 papers), Shoulder and Clavicle Injuries (15 papers) and Total Knee Arthroplasty Outcomes (15 papers). Jacob D. Mikula collaborates with scholars based in United States, Germany and Norway. Jacob D. Mikula's co-authors include Robert F. LaPrade, Travis Lee Turnbull, Erik L. Slette, Daniel Cole Marchetti, Jason M. Schon, Grant J. Dornan, Alex W. Brady, Matthew Kheir, Kimi D. Dahl and Jorge Chahla and has published in prestigious journals such as The American Journal of Sports Medicine, Clinical Orthopaedics and Related Research and Osteoporosis International.
